Missing Person Body of Summerville, NJ Man Found

The body found in a pond near Spruce Run Reservoir this morning has been identified as David B. Swanson, 51, of Somerville, the Hunterdon County prosecutor and the State Police have announced.

The body was found in 6 feet of water, about 70 yards off shore. Determination of the cause and manner of death is pending.

Swanson’s family reported him missing yesterday at about 5:30 p.m. “after he did not return from fishing in the area around Spruce Run state park,” Prosecutor Anthony P. Kearns III said.

State Police, State Park Police and conservation officers from the New Jersey Division of Fish and Wildlife began searching the area immediately with troopers from Perryville station and a helicopter from the NJSP Aviation Unit.

Swanson’s vehicle was found on a dirt road “in a remote area near a small pond not far from the reservoir,” Kearns said.

The pond where the body was found is near the intersection of Van Syckles and Henderson roads.

The search continued today with additional troopers from the Missing Persons unit, detectives from the Prosecutor’s Office, and divers from the State Police TEAMS unit.

Divers found a capsized canoe, Kearns said, before recovering a fully clothed body with boots on its feet around 11:40 a.m.
Swanson was not wearing a personal flotation device, Kearns said.

The Hunterdon County medical examiner made a positive identification.

“Our prayers are with Mr. Swanson’s friends and family during their time of grief,” Kearns said.

On the State Police website, Swanson was listed as a missing person with a notation, “He does go kayaking and does go to different areas along the Raritan River or Millstone River in Somerset or Hunterdon counties.”
